What are the responsibilities and job description for the BRANCH ASSISTANT GENERAL MANAGER position at SELECT EVENT GROUP INC?
Job Details
Description
Leadership, Management & Accountability
- Act as the General Manager in the absence of the General Manager
- Act as Event Sales/Rental Consultant as necessary
- Establish strong working relationships and demonstrate leadership with fellow team members, especially event team and operations
- Provide training and support to other members of team including Event Sales/Rental Consultant and Event Coordinators
- Support the General Manager in the management of the book of business- to include but not limited to:
- Pricing decisions
- Analyzing margin results compared to goal
- Client touchpoints as mutually agreed upon with team
- Approve payment for all contracted services invoices related to event management by team ensuring all procedures are being followed.
- Review the administrative work of the other team members for accuracy and ensure the event production tasks are being completed in line with the expectations
- Display a high level of leadership amongst each team and ensure all teams are motivated and successful in achieving the goals of the department
Event Lifecyle Administration:
- Manage job-specific information throughout the entire event lifecycle
- Create and maintain equipment reservation tickets
- Complete job costing for each event and update with actuals costs after event is complete
- Create job folders and make sure they are kept up to date with all relevant documents
- Write customer proposals
- Job closing and submittal of contracted services invoices for payment
- Client Invoicing and collecting payment
- Act as liaison and facilitate communication between sales team and operations as needed
Customer Service:
- Provide high level of customer service and professionalism
- Ensure Studio is always “client ready” and up to Select’s standards
- Serve as second point of contact for clients as needed
- Participate in on-call rotation as needed to support clients and team after hours/weekends
Inventory & Office Management:
- Assist in inventory management by strategically updating inventory parts on reservations and submitting overbookings
- Relay any job-related issues experienced by Operations team back to the Sales team
- Assist General Manager in maintaining office/showroom supply inventory
